How to Gift Data on EE: A Comprehensive Guide
Introduction to EE Data Gifting
EE, one of the leading mobile network providers, offers a convenient feature known as data gifting that allows you to share your mobile data with friends and family. This service enables EE customers to transfer data allowances to other EE numbers effortlessly.
Ways to Gift Data on EE
1. Using the EE App
If you prefer a quick and simple method to gift data on EE, you can use the My EE app. Follow these steps:
- Open the My EE app on your mobile device.
- Navigate to the Gift Data section.
- Select the amount of data you wish to gift and the recipients EE number.
- Confirm the transaction to complete the data gifting process.
2. Via Text Message
For those who prefer not to use the app, you can gift data on EE through a text message. Simply send a text with the recipients number and the amount of data you want to transfer to a specific shortcode provided by EE.
3. Using My EE Online Account
If you prefer managing your EE account online, you can gift data by logging into your My EE account on the EE website. From there, you can easily navigate to the data gifting section and follow the prompts to transfer data.

FAQs about Data Gifting on EE
- Can I gift data on EE to a friend?
Yes, you can gift data to any EE number, whether its a family member, friend, or colleague. - How do I gift data on EE to another network?
EE data gifting is restricted to transferring data between EE numbers only. - Is it possible to share EE data with non-EE users?
EEs data gifting service is exclusive to EE customers and cannot be used to transfer data to non-EE networks.
